Eric Szymczyk made 16 saves Wednesday night, leading the Dryden Ice Dogs to a 4-0 win over the visiting Thunder Bay North Stars.
Paul Thompson scored twice for Dryden, with singles going to Rory Court, who opened the scoring at 6:48 of the second, and Chris Belhumeur.
It was the seventh straight loss for the Stars (25-24-1), who are buried in last place in the Superior International Junior Hockey League standings.
The third-place Ice Dogs improved to 28-24-2.
